Experimental IC<sub>50</sub> values and transactivation activity of the selected compounds.

A competitive binding assay was used to assess the ability of experimental compounds, FMOC or rosiglitazone to displace a fluorescent PPARγ ligand from a human-derived recombinant PPARγ ligand-binding domain. The concentration of the test compound that results in a half-maximal shift in the polarization value is defined as IC50. This value is a measure of the relative affinity of the test compound for the PPAR ligand-binding domain. The transactivation capacity of selected compounds was also determined in HepG2 cells as described in Materials and Methods. Results represent the mean ± SD of at least three separate experiments performed in triplicate. Results are expressed as arbitrary firefly luciferase units relative to arbitrary renilla luciferase units. For compounds C2, C3 and C6, no binding was observed when assayed at concentrations up to 8 mM. Compounds C4 and C10 were not assayed because of solubility problems. For Rosiglitazone and FMOC, gene reporter activity at 500 and 1000 μM were not assayed because of solubility problems. **p<0.001 and * p<0.05 when compared to the control (DMSO) in an ANOVA test.
